About Government Contract Law in Makati City, Philippines

Government contract law in Makati City, Philippines involves the body of regulations that govern transactions between the private sector and the various city government agencies. It encompasses procurement, bidding, awarding, and enforcement of government contracts for goods, services, or public works. Legal issues regarding these contracts may arise regarding interpretations of contract provisions, procurement process, contract negotiations and formation, performance disputes, and potential breaches of contracts.

Local Laws Overview

The Government Procurement Reform Act (Republic Act No. 9184) is the primary law that regulates government contracts in the Philippines, including Makati City. This law sets out the procedure for public bidding, contract awarding, and how any disputes will be resolved. Additionally, the Local Government Code (Republic Act No. 7160) also outlines various local governance regulations which often come into play in government contract dealings at the city level.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can a non-Filipino citizen bid for a government contract in Makati City?

Yes, under certain circumstances a non-Filipino citizen or foreign corporation can bid for government contracts. However, there are certain limitations and requirements that must be met under Philippine law.

2. What happens if there is a dispute over a government contract?

Contract disputes are usually settled according to the dispute resolution provisions stipulated in the contract. If not specified, disputes may be resolved through administrative, judicial, or alternative dispute resolution mechanisms.

3. Does Makati City government have a preference for local contractors?

While the law does not explicitly state a preference for local contractors, certain provisions may give a competitive advantage to local contractors, such as those related to local sourcing of materials and labor.

4. Can I negotiate the terms of a government contract?

Most standard terms in a government contract are non-negotiable. However, certain aspects, such as performance timelines or specific project scope, might be negotiated.

Additional Resources

The Government Procurement Policy Board (GPPB) and the Philippine Government Electronic Procurement System (PhilGEPS) are important resources for understanding the government contracting process. Another useful resource is the Makati City Government website, where local ordinances and city contracts are often published.
